Abstract
A surgical stapler comprising a handle assembly, an elongated body portion extending distally from the handle assembly, and a head portion disposed adjacent a distal portion of the elongated body portion and including an anvil assembly and a shell assembly. The anvil assembly is movable in relation to the shell assembly between spaced and approximated positions. The anvil assembly has an anvil head and a plurality of projections extending proximally of the anvil head, the projections engageable with a portion of the shell assembly.

11. A method of performing a surgical procedure comprising:
-
inserting an anvil assembly of a surgical fastener applying apparatus into an opening in a patient; connecting the anvil assembly to a shell assembly of the surgical apparatus; approximating the anvil assembly and the shell assembly such that a projection extending proximally from an annular tissue contacting surface of the anvil assembly is inserted into a corresponding opening formed in an annular tissue contacting surface of the shell assembly in alignment with the projection, wherein the opening is spaced radially inward from a plurality of slots formed in the tissue contacting surface of the shell assembly and spaced radially outward from a central aperture of the shell assembly; and firing the surgical apparatus to eject a plurality of surgical fasteners through the plurality of slots formed in the tissue contacting surface of the shell assembly, and into tissue positioned between the anvil assembly and the shell assembly. - View Dependent Claims (12, 13, 14, 15, 16)
